From e996223c2f8717bb50f5c35fac6a5cd0449a36ef Mon Sep 17 00:00:00 2001 From: wangyu <727842003@qq.com> Date: Tue, 18 Jan 2022 16:17:09 +0800 Subject: [PATCH] =?UTF-8?q?feat=EF=BC=9A=E5=AE=9E=E7=8E=B0=E5=8A=A8?= =?UTF-8?q?=E6=80=81=E5=93=8D=E5=BA=94=E5=A4=84=E7=90=86?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../flyfish/framework/controller/UserController.java | 12 ++++++++++++ flyfish-web/pom.xml | 5 +++++ .../flyfish/framework/configuration/backup/.gitkeep | 1 + pom.xml | 2 +- 4 files changed, 19 insertions(+), 1 deletion(-) create mode 100644 flyfish-web/src/main/java/com/flyfish/framework/configuration/backup/.gitkeep diff --git a/flyfish-user/src/main/java/com/flyfish/framework/controller/UserController.java b/flyfish-user/src/main/java/com/flyfish/framework/controller/UserController.java index b264fab..4591409 100644 --- a/flyfish-user/src/main/java/com/flyfish/framework/controller/UserController.java +++ b/flyfish-user/src/main/java/com/flyfish/framework/controller/UserController.java @@ -52,6 +52,18 @@ public class UserController extends ReactiveBaseController { return reactiveService.updateSelectiveById(updating).thenReturn(Result.ok()); } + /** + * 找回密码逻辑 + * 需要正确输入用户名,邮箱 + * + * @return 结果 + */ + @PostMapping("forget") + @Operation("密码找回") + public Mono> forgetPassword() { + return Mono.empty(); + } + /** * 修改密码逻辑 * diff --git a/flyfish-web/pom.xml b/flyfish-web/pom.xml index c4545c9..5702ef0 100644 --- a/flyfish-web/pom.xml +++ b/flyfish-web/pom.xml @@ -33,6 +33,11 @@ spring-boot-starter-cache + + + + + org.springframework.boot spring-boot-starter-data-redis diff --git a/flyfish-web/src/main/java/com/flyfish/framework/configuration/backup/.gitkeep b/flyfish-web/src/main/java/com/flyfish/framework/configuration/backup/.gitkeep new file mode 100644 index 0000000..3a1988b --- /dev/null +++ b/flyfish-web/src/main/java/com/flyfish/framework/configuration/backup/.gitkeep @@ -0,0 +1 @@ +预留备份配置 diff --git a/pom.xml b/pom.xml index 9ffb782..f30629f 100644 --- a/pom.xml +++ b/pom.xml @@ -52,7 +52,7 @@ central - http://nexus.flyfish.group/repository/maven-public/ + https://maven.aliyun.com/repository/public